On Wed, Mar 30, 2005 at 10:14:35PM +0200, Matteo Riondato wrote:
>My card is a .11g card onboard my Asus A8V-E Deluxe motherboard.
>BTW, am I supposed to use 64bit drivers or 32bit drivers with NDIS?
I have an A8V Deluxe/WiFi-G, and don't know how much it differs from
the A8V-E.
My WiFi-G was a separate PCI card which I actually installed on a
Win2K/WinXP machine with a different motherboard. The chipset is a
RaLink, and I briefly tried to find Linux drivers for for it. (The
machine now runs 5-STABLE/amd64, but was cross-booting into various
Linux/i686 and /x86_64 versions for a while, partly to track down a
working VMWare 4.) I note that OpenBSD now has native drivers
for this chipset.
Of course, if the onboard chipset for the -E is different, this
information wont help you at all...
